A study examined waiting times in die X-ray department for a hospital in Jacksonville, Florida. A clerk recorded the number of patients waiting for service at 9:00 A.M. on 20 consecutive days and obtained the following results.
Number of Days
Number Waiting Outcome Occurred
0 2
1 5
2 6
3 4
4 3
Total 20
a. Define the experiment the clerk conducted.
b. List the experimental outcomes.
c. Assign probabilities to the experimental outcomes.
d. What method did you use?
